Mosquito Bites - Protecting Yourself

To help protect your and your family from the West Nile Virus, follow the guidelines below. 

Apply insect repellent containing DEET. Mosquitos may bite through clothing,
     so spraying your clothes with the repellent can give you extra protection.

Wear appropriate clothing. When possible, wear long-sleeves, long pants
     and socks when outdoors.

Be aware of peak mosquito hours. The hours from dusk to dawn are peak
    mosquito biting times. 

Drain standing water. Mosquitoes lay their eggs in standing water.  Limit the
     number of places around your home for mosquitoes to breed by getting
     rid of items that hold water.

Install or repair screens. Some mosquitoes like to come indoors.  Keep them
     outside by having well-fitting screens on both windows and doors.
